Criminal acts:
Those who have broken the law, but are not worthy of death, usually served prison time or menial labor until their sentence is served.
To pay off debts:
Those who have large amounts of debt but had no money to pay generally were able to pay off their debt through working for their debtor.
Prisoner of war:
Prisoners were a large source of potential slaves who can be used to help construct infrastructure within a nation. Examples can be found in Rome subduing many of the Barbaric tribes in the North.
